### Reviewing tide-table widget changes

The Moonreach widget caches tidal predictions per harbor for six hours. Any change touching the interpolation step must include updated snapshot tests for the Kelsmere and Dunvarrow sample harbors. Reject changes that alter the cache key format without a migration note. The full review checklist, including the datum-offset gotchas, lives on the internal page here.

wiki page, tahaf-tajog: https://jira.ordindyn.corp/pipeline

Internal Memo — Move to Annual Billing

To the board: Sellwick Software will shift the Paratel product line from monthly to annual billing starting next fiscal year. Expected effects: improved cash position, lower churn, modest near-term revenue timing shift. Existing customers migrate at renewal; no forced conversions. Finance has modeled three scenarios, all favorable. Rollout communications are drafted. The underlying strategic rationale is set out confidentially below.

board note of kageg-bahof: The renewal with Holwynax Holdings closes at $2 million a year, 5 percent below the last contract. Project Ulaath slips by two quarters because of the supplier delay.

[ ] Before starting the Tollgate key ceremony, make sure the Brindlepay integration suite is green — yes, really, all of it. The settlement-retry tests flake when the mock ledger lags, so run them twice before declaring failure. We gate the ceremony on these because rotating signing keys with a red build has burned us before (ask Priya about the March incident). Once you've got two consecutive green runs, you'll need the ceremony vault open, which requires the standing recovery passphrase noted here:

recovery phrase for tafof-tagag: kaseth-brivan-pelmir-istmir-istax-pelath-sorael-praax-sorix-norwyn-frador-praok-istir-juleth

Onboarding: template rendering on Fernwheel is the top support driver. Slow renders almost always mean a merchant embedded unbounded loops in a Quillstone template; check the render-time header first. Over 4s: advise the merchant to paginate. Over 10s: the renderer kills the job and returns a partial page — that's expected, not a bug. Don't promise renderer config changes; that's the platform team. Escalations on renderer internals go to the address below.

escalation mailbox, badug-tawip: ulaath@nelvroforge.example